如何在 LUMEN 5.2 中激活会话

Posted

技术标签:

【中文标题】如何在 LUMEN 5.2 中激活会话【英文标题】:How to activate sessions in LUMEN 5.2 【发布时间】:2016-09-07 14:34:06 【问题描述】:

我是 Lumen 的新手,我需要使用 Session 功能,但基于站点中的更改日志。 Sessions 在最新版本中被排除在外,我已经在 Lumen 5.2 的文档中查找过,它说我应该参考 Laravel 激活会话的方式之类的东西。我的问题是我也没有在 Laravel 中使用的经验。谁能告诉我,逐步激活 Lumen Sessions 的方法? 或者谁能​​推荐一个第三方库?

【问题讨论】:

Check this 【参考方案1】:

Lumen 中没有内置会话支持。来自release notes:

...会话和视图不再包含在框架中。如果您需要访问这些功能,您应该使用完整的 Laravel 框架。

您应该 install Laravel 框架而不是 Lumen,并在会话中引用其 docs。

另外,默认的php sessions 仍然可用。

【讨论】:

哦,谢谢。我想我应该使用身份验证提供程序。

以上是关于如何在 LUMEN 5.2 中激活会话的主要内容,如果未能解决你的问题,请参考以下文章

如何在流明 5.2 中设置时区?

如何在新安装时指定 Lumen(或 Laravel)版本?

Lumen 5.2+ 中的视图

Laravel Lumen 5.2 Cors 中间件不工作

在没有 Lumen/Laravel 会话的情况下使用 Lumen + Dingo + JWT

为啥从 Lumen 5.2 中删除了 artisan serve 命令?